**Ticket: KeyMill rotation skips stale vault entries**

Hey sec team — KeyMill's nightly rotation quietly skips any secret last touched over 90 days ago, which is exactly backwards. Found while auditing the Brindlewood staging vault. No evidence of exposure, but old creds stayed live longer than policy allows. Fix is in review; repro steps attached. The failing run's token is below.

build token for kafof-bagug: htk4_300a

# ---------------------------------------------------------
# Constants for the Graywick GPU memory profiling module.
# These control sampling cadence, snapshot compression, and
# the alert threshold for fragmentation on Hollis-class
# training nodes. Changing any value requires a release-notes
# entry, since downstream dashboards at Bryndale parse the
# snapshot format. Values were last validated during the
# 4.2 soak test. The current constants are defined below.
# ---------------------------------------------------------

tuning constants:
QUOTAS = {
    "druwyn": 5,
    "holix": 5,
    "zorath": 5,
    "holwyn": 10,
}

Quarterly Planning Note — Finance Team, Brindlewick Software

Quick heads-up: we're moving Fernpath subscriptions to annual billing from Q3. Expect a short-term dip in monthly cash receipts, then a bump once renewals land. Dario's team will update the invoicing templates, and we'll need revised deferred-revenue schedules by end of month. Churn modelling looks encouraging so far. Full context on why we're doing this now is in the confidential note below.

management briefing: The renewal with Zoraelax Group closes at $10 million a year, 15 percent below the last contract. Project Ralael slips by six weeks because of the audit delay.